--- id: spring_gateway title: Monitoring Spring Cloud Gateway sidebar_label: Spring Cloud Gateway keywords: [open source monitoring tool, open source Spring Cloud Gateway monitoring tool, monitoring Spring Cloud Gateway metrics] --- > Collect and monitor the general performance metrics exposed by the SpringBoot actuator. ## Pre-monitoring operations If you want to monitor information in `Spring Cloud Gateway` with this monitoring type, you need to integrate your `Spring Cloud Gateway` application and enable the SpringBoot Actuator. **1、Add POM .XML dependencies:** ```xml org.springframework.boot spring-boot-starter-actuator ``` **2. Modify the YML configuration exposure metric interface:** ```yaml management: endpoint: gateway: enabled: true env: show-values: ALWAYS endpoints: web: exposure: include: "*" ``` ### Configure parameters | Parameter name | Parameter Help describes the | |-----------------------------|--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------| | Monitor Host | THE MONITORED PEER IPV4, IPV6 OR DOMAIN NAME. Note ⚠️ that there are no protocol headers (eg: https://, http://). | | Monitoring Name | A name that identifies this monitoring that needs to be unique. | | Port | The default port provided by the database is 8080. | | Enable HTTPS | Whether to access the website through HTTPS, please note that ⚠️ when HTTPS is enabled, the default port needs to be changed to 443 | | The acquisition interval is | Monitor the periodic data acquisition interval, in seconds, and the minimum interval that can be set is 30 seconds | | Whether to probe the | Whether to check the availability of the monitoring before adding a monitoring is successful, and the new modification operation will continue only if the probe is successful | | Description Comment | For more information identifying and describing the remarks for this monitoring, users can remark the information here | ### Collect metrics #### metric Collection: Health | Metric Name | metric unit | Metrics help describe | |-------------|-------------|--------------------------| | status | None | Service health: UP, Down | #### metric Collection: environment | Metric Name | metric unit | Metrics help describe | |-------------|-------------|-----------------------------------------------| | profile | None | The application runs profile: prod, dev, test | | port | None | Apply the exposed port | | os | None | Run the operating system | | os_arch | None | Run the operating system architecture | | jdk_vendor | None | jdk vendor | | jvm_version | None | jvm version | #### metric Collection: threads | Metric Name | metric unit | Metrics help describe | |-------------|-------------|----------------------------------| | state | None | Thread status | | number | None | This thread state corresponds to number of threads | #### metric Collection: memory_used | Metric Name | metric unit | Metrics help describe | |-------------|-------------|--------------------------------------| | space | None | Memory space name | | mem_used | MB | This space occupies a memory size of | #### metric Collection: route_info | Metric Name | metric unit | Metrics help describe | |-------------|-------------|---------------------------------------| | route_id | None | Route id | | predicate | None | This is a routing matching rule | | uri | None | This is a service resource identifier | | order | None | The priority of this route |
